The Science and Technology Course of the Faculty of Science and Technology (FCT) at UFMT, offered in Distance Education mode, was developed from extensive discussions with the academic community in 2021. Its Pedagogical Project (PPC) reflects the institutional commitment to meet the demands of Mato Grosso society, training professionals with a solid scientific foundation and broad understanding of contemporary technologies. The PPC organizes priorities, actions, and strategies that ensure the development of competencies and skills outlined in the graduate profile, aligning with institutional guidelines, MEC regulations, and national evaluation instruments such as Enade. It is a dynamic document that undergoes periodic evaluations to ensure continuous updating and improvement. Committed to comprehensive training, the course seeks to prepare professionals capable of understanding and acting critically in the social, environmental, political, and economic context in which they are inserted, contributing to the scientific, technological, and educational development of the State.

The Natural Sciences and Mathematics Teaching Degree Course, offered in distance mode by UFMT through the UAB System, aims to train teachers capable of contextualizing teaching to the social, cultural, and economic realities of Mato Grosso municipalities. The training proposal integrates scientific, pedagogical, and didactic knowledge, preparing future teachers to act as transforming agents of society. The course seeks to stimulate scientific curiosity, research, university extension, and citizenship exercise, promoting ethical, critical, collaborative, and socially responsible teaching practice. Graduates are prepared to understand teaching as a cultural practice, valuing diversity, strengthening inclusive education, and using educational technologies and innovative approaches such as STEM. Offered at UAB centers in Cuiabá, Tangará da Serra, Sorriso, and Lucas do Rio Verde, the course aims to train teachers capable of transforming the classroom into a space for research, experimentation, and knowledge construction, mastering theoretical and practical content and applying interdisciplinary and meaningful methodologies. Upon completing their training, graduates will be qualified to teach Science and Mathematics in basic education, committed to learning, human development, and promoting science in society.

It is a training process targeting teachers, especially pedagogical coordinators from the public network in Elementary Education, to reflect on and improve political-pedagogical interventions in school units focused on building School and Community Environmental Projects in states of the North and Midwest regions of the country. The project seeks to understand pedagogical processes with or without the use of communication and information technologies that occur in 11 Brazilian capitals, through their school units, in order to strengthen and understand Environmental Education, with emphasis on Climate Justice, in elementary education.

This project investigates the evolution of technological infrastructure implementation policies in the Mato Grosso state education network. In a context marked by digital culture, it seeks to understand how schools have been equipped to integrate digital technologies into the teaching-learning process. The research will conduct bibliographic and documentary surveys to analyze initiatives such as the Digital Inclusion Program, which in 2016 provided one thousand tablets to state network students, and the EducAção 10-year plan, which in 2024 planned to deliver chromebooks, notebooks, and smart TVs to modernize public education. By mapping these actions, the study aims to offer a clear view of the trajectory of technological policies in the state and their impacts on pedagogical practices.

This project seeks to scientifically investigate innovations in education and technology present in Virtual Learning Environments (VLEs) and digital solutions used in educational contexts. The objective is to understand how these technologies are implemented, what pedagogical practices they promote, and what impacts they generate in institutions, especially in the context of FCT distance education courses and partnerships between INOVATEC and TCE-MT, linked to PPGE/UFMT research. The research, with a qualitative and applied approach, involves literature review, document analysis, case studies, prototype development, and evaluations based on pedagogical and technological indicators. Surveys will be conducted on VLE use, institutional needs diagnoses, analysis of technological solutions, and development of innovation projects. Expected results include the production of technological diagnoses and mappings, creation and evaluation of innovative solutions, and dissemination of knowledge that strengthens and qualifies educational processes in the involved institutions.

This project, developed within the scope of UFMT's Graduate Program in Education (PPGE), focuses on analyzing the use of Artificial Intelligence (AI) in Education, especially in the context of Distance Education (DE). The research is based on a survey using the European Framework for Digital Competence for Educators (DigCompEdu), which identified, among UFMT faculty, the need for institutional policies aimed at strengthening digital competencies, including training actions and encouragement of collaborative work. In this new stage, the study will investigate the challenges faced by educators in using AI services and tools — with emphasis on generative AI — and the legal, ethical, and pedagogical implications of this use. Issues such as the legality and ethics of using content for training AI models will be analyzed, as well as the effects of these technologies on traditional assessment practices. By exploring benefits, risks, and limitations of AI in higher education, especially in DE, the project seeks to contribute to understanding and developing training strategies that prepare teachers and students to deal critically, safely, and efficiently with AI use in the educational process.

This project aims to contribute to improving the quality of distance higher education at UFMT, focusing on the main evaluation indicators: General Course Index (IGC), Preliminary Course Concept (CPC), and National Student Performance Exam (Enade). The research begins with a historical survey of data on these indicators related to the institution's distance undergraduate courses, analyzing their behavior and impact from 2016 to 2021. Subsequently, the results of internal and external evaluations will be examined, relating them to the axes of the National Digital Education Policy and the digital competencies necessary for contemporary education. Based on these analyses, the study seeks to support the definition of improvement strategies for UFMT's distance education courses, contributing to strengthening institutional quality and advancing performance indicators.
